In the UK, mental health and addiction counseling professionals are in demand, particularly those with a Postgraduate Certificate in Dual Diagnosis Counseling Techniques. This chart highlights the percentage distribution of several roles related to this field, providing a snapshot of job market trends. 1. **Addiction Counselor**: 45% of positions are in this category. Professionals in this role help individuals struggling with substance abuse problems and offer guidance throughout the recovery process. 2. **Mental Health Counselor**: 30% of available roles focus on mental health counseling. These professionals diagnose and treat various mental health disorders, working closely with patients to develop coping strategies. 3. **Clinical Social Worker**: 10% of positions involve social work. Clinical social workers assess and treat clients' mental, emotional, and behavioral issues while coordinating with other healthcare professionals. 4. **Marriage and Family Therapist**: 15% of roles are centered around marriage and family therapy. These professionals help couples and families navigate interpersonal challenges and develop healthier communication strategies. These roles are essential in providing comprehensive care for individuals facing dual diagnosis issues.
